a.njhejgfuytgrygfrvytfyr img{display:block}.account_and_buttons_bs.head a img{max-width:50px}summary.header__icon.header__icon--menu.header__icon--summary.link.focus-inset{width:0;height:0;opacity:0}.custom_product_home_page.product_page_bs.ee.banana dl.crossed-price{color:#ac6462!important}.promo-section p.footer-text{-webkit-text-stroke:.5px #334675}.text_with_animation_bs img{max-width:50px}.text_with_animation_bs{font-family:OhnoSoftieDemo-Medium;font-size:48px;max-width:76%;margin:auto;position:absolute;z-index:2;top:15vw;left:12%;color:#808ba8;line-height:56px}.text_with_animation_bs h2{font-family:OhnoSoftieDemo-Medium;font-size:48px;margin:auto;color:#fff;line-height:56px}.custom-banner-section-bs img{width:100%;transform:translate(0)}footer.footer .footer-bottom{display:flex;justify-content:space-between}button.Choco_Hazel_button a,button.Banana_Berry_button a{display:block;line-height:2}.text_with_animation_bs{font-family:OhnoSoftieDemo-Medium;font-size:48px;max-width:100%;margin:auto;position:absolute;z-index:2;top:20vw;left:0;color:#808ba8;line-height:56px;width:100%}button.drawer__close svg{max-width:20px}.custom-banner-section-bs img{width:100%}.variant_title_bs_product_custom.pr_titile{width:40%}.variant_title_bs_product_custom{display:flex;align-items:flex-end}.variant_title_bs_product_custom.pr_titile{align-items:flex-start}.variant_title_bs_product_custom p{font-weight:700;color:#4d2c17b8;font-size:20px}.variant_title_bs_product_custom span{font-size:15px;color:#4d2c17a3;display:flex}.variant_title_bs_product_custom.eeee p{display:flex;align-items:center;gap:4px}.variant_title_bs_product_custom.eeee{width:32%}.footer-column.footer-licenses p,.footer-column.footer-contact p{color:#59759e!important}.variant_title_bs_product_custom.eeee span.small-text{font-weight:100}.variant_button_bs_pack{padding:12px 2rem!important}h2.text_with_animation_bs_text{max-width:114rem;margin:auto}.ViewAllNutritionalDetails .content-section-bs{position:relative}.ViewAllNutritionalDetails .content-section-bs:after{position:absolute;top:54rem;width:100%;height:48%;z-index:2;background:transparent;content:"";left:0}.custom-banner-section-bs.about_us_image_content_bs{margin-top:24rem}.social-buttons{padding-top:0!important}section#custom-newsletter{padding-top:0;margin-bottom:6rem}h2.jdgm-rev-widg__title{font-family:PufflingV03}h2.drawer__heading{text-align:left}h2.drawer__heading{text-align:left;font-family:PufflingV03;font-size:30px}table.cart-items p,table.cart-items a,table.cart-items dt,table.cart-items dd,table.cart-items div{font-family:OhnoSoftieDemo-Regular,sans-serif}.drawer__inner{height:100%;width:50rem!important}.cart-drawer__footer h2,.cart-drawer__footer p,.cart-drawer__footer small,button#CartDrawer-Checkout{font-family:OhnoSoftieDemo-Regular,sans-serif!important;text-align:left}.cart-drawer__footer p.totals__total-value{margin:0;width:14rem}.cart-count-bubble span{font-family:OhnoSoftieDemo-Regular;font-size:14px}.cart-count-bubble{top:-8px;left:3rem;background:linear-gradient(180deg,#4d81ff,#275ddf);width:2rem}.drawer.active .drawer__inner{background-image:url(/cdn/shop/files/tre_1.png?v=1742368014);background-size:cover;width:60rem!important}.drawer__close .svg-wrapper{width:42px;height:42px;display:block}button.drawer__close svg{max-width:42px}.cart-drawer .cart-items thead th:nth-child(2){font-size:14px;font-family:OhnoSoftieDemo-Regular,sans-serif;padding-bottom:1rem}th#CartDrawer-ColumnTotal{font-size:14px;font-family:OhnoSoftieDemo-Regular,sans-serif;padding-bottom:1rem}cart-drawer-items::-webkit-scrollbar{display:none}.cart-item__media{width:20rem!important}.cart-drawer .cart-item__image{max-width:100%;width:200px!important;display:block}tr.cart-item.choco-hazel{background:#f1dbbe;padding-right:1.5rem;border-radius:20px}.cart-drawer .cart-items td{padding-top:0!important}a.cart-item__name.h4{text-align:left;font-family:PufflingV03;font-size:26px;color:#4d2c17;padding-top:1.5rem}td.cart-item__details dt,td.cart-item__details dd{font-family:Ohno Softie Demo;font-weight:400;font-size:18px;line-height:28px}.quantity:before,.quantity:after{opacity:0!important}quantity-input.quantity.cart-quantity{background:linear-gradient(180deg,#fff,#edf2ff);border:2px solid #275DDF14!important;border-radius:10px;border-width:2px}quantity-input.quantity.cart-quantity button,quantity-input.quantity.cart-quantity input{font-family:Ohno Softie Demo;font-weight:500;font-size:18px;line-height:24px;color:#275ddf}.cart-item__price-wrapper{padding-top:2.5rem}.cart-item__quantity-wrapper{display:flex;justify-content:space-between}tr.cart-item{margin-bottom:1.5rem!important}tr.cart-item.cloud-shake{background:#f6c8b7;padding-right:1.5rem;border-radius:20px}tr.cart-item.cloud-shake a.cart-item__name.h4.break,tr.cart-item.cloud-shake .product-option,tr.cart-item.cloud-shake .cart-item__price-wrapper>*:only-child{color:#8c2825}h2.totals__total{font-weight:500;font-size:20px!important;line-height:28px}.cart-drawer__footer p.totals__total-value{margin:0;width:16rem;font-weight:600;font-size:22px;line-height:28px}.cart-drawer .tax-note{margin:1.2rem 0 2rem auto;text-align:left;font-weight:400;font-size:14px;line-height:28px}.drawer__footer{border:none}#CartDrawer-Checkout:after{opacity:0}button#CartDrawer-Checkout{background:linear-gradient(180deg,#4d81ff,#275ddf);box-shadow:0 42px 12px #004cff00;gap:318px;border-radius:16px;padding:16px 32px;font-weight:694;font-size:24px;line-height:32px;font-family:PufflingV03!important}.drawer__footer{border:none!important}div#menu-drawer{background-image:url(/cdn/shop/files/Frame_1000012952.png?v=1740559232);background-size:cover}section.custom-content-section2 h1.section-heading{text-align:left;font-family:PufflingV03;font-size:60px!important}@media screen and (min-width: 768px) and (max-width: 1300px){.drawer.active .drawer__inner{width:54rem!important}.cart-drawer.cart-drawer .cart-item__price-wrapper>*:only-child{white-space:nowrap}.see-all-ingredients2.see-all-ingredients2-desktop.see-all-ingredients2-mobile{bottom:7%}div#shopify-section-template--16984517738652__homepage_goog_stuff_LLnq3T .see-all-ingredients2.see-all-ingredients2-desktop.see-all-ingredients2-mobile{bottom:4%}}@media screen and (max-width: 768px){.account_and_buttons_bs.head a{font-family:OhnoSoftieDemo-Regular,sans-serif;font-size:28px}.logo_header.head img{max-width:80%;margin:auto}.logo_header.head{margin:auto;text-align:center}.cart-item__media{width:10rem!important}a.cart-item__name.h4{text-align:left;font-family:PufflingV03;font-size:18px;color:#4d2c17;padding-top:1.5rem}td.cart-item__details dt,td.cart-item__details dd{font-family:Ohno Softie Demo;font-weight:400;font-size:14px;line-height:28px}.drawer.active .drawer__inner{background-image:url(/cdn/shop/files/tre_1.png?v=1742368014);background-size:cover;width:100%!important;max-width:100%!important}.cart-drawer .cart-item>td+td{padding-left:0}.custom-banner-section-bs.about_us_image_content_bs{margin-top:0;margin-bottom:14rem}.custom-newsletter{padding-top:0!important}.social-buttons{padding-top:3rem!important}img.content-bottom-image-desktop-bs.img-adjust{display:none}img.content-bottom-image-mobile-bs.img-adjust{display:block}.variant_title_bs_product_custom p{font-weight:700;color:#4d2c17b8;font-size:18px;line-height:normal}.variant_title_bs_product_custom.eeee{width:40%;max-width:100%}.variant_button_bs_pack{padding:12px 1rem!important}.variant_title_bs_product_custom p{font-weight:500!important}.variant_title_bs_product_custom.pr_titile{width:max-content;max-width:100%!important}.product_variant_list product-form{margin-left:10px}.variant_title_bs_product_custom.pr_titile{width:32%;max-width:100%!important}.product_variant_list{border-top:2px solid #E4CDB1}div#shopify-section-template--16984517902492__custom_slideshow_VfUaPT{margin-top:-5rem}.cart-drawer__footer p.totals__total-value{margin:0;width:16rem;font-weight:600;font-size:18px;line-height:28px}.custom_product_home_page.product_page_bs{padding-top:10rem;margin-top:-6rem}.left_cta_buttons.head{margin-right:1rem}.account_and_buttons_bs.head{margin-left:.7rem}td.cart-item__details dt,td.cart-item__details dd{font-family:Ohno Softie Demo;font-weight:400;font-size:12px;line-height:28px}.cart-drawer .cart-item>td+td{padding-left:0!important}td.cart-item__totals.right{width:7.5rem}.product-option+.product-option{margin-top:0!important}a.cart-item__name.h4{padding-top:.5rem}.cart-item__details>*+*{margin-top:0!important}.cart-item__price-wrapper{padding-top:1.5rem}.cart-drawer .price{font-size:14px;white-space:nowrap}.product-option+.product-option{margin-top:-10px!important}quantity-input.quantity.cart-quantity{min-height:36px}.cart-drawer .cart-item{row-gap:0!important}cart-remove-button .button{min-height:auto!important}.cart-drawer .cart-item__image{max-width:100%;min-height:12rem;object-fit:cover;border-radius:12px 0 0 12px}.social-buttons{display:flex;justify-content:space-between!important;gap:10px;padding:20px 2rem!important}.contact-form{padding:0 2rem}.newsletter-input{width:auto!important}.newsletter-button{width:100%!important}.newsletter-input{width:auto!important;padding:1rem!important}.newsletter-wrapper{max-width:100%!important;padding:0 2rem}.contact-form{padding:0!important}.social-button img{width:16px!important;height:16px!important;position:absolute;right:4rem;top:50%;transform:translateY(-50%);right:8px!important}.social-button{padding-left:5px!important}.ViewAllNutritionalDetailseee img.mobile_popoViewAllNutritionalDetailseee{margin-top:-2rem}.cart-drawer__footer p.totals__total-value{margin:0;width:max-content;font-weight:600;font-size:18px;line-height:28px;white-space:nowrap}.social-button img{position:initial;width:100%!important;height:auto!important;transform:none!important}.social-buttons{padding:2rem 1rem 0px!important}.social-button{padding-left:0!important}.text_with_animation_bs img{max-width:56px}.text_with_animation_bs h2{font-family:OhnoSoftieDemo-Medium;font-size:32px;margin:auto;color:#fff;line-height:38px}.text_with_animation_bs h2{font-family:OhnoSoftieDemo-Medium;font-size:33px;margin:auto;color:#fff;line-height:38px;max-width:33rem!important}.text_with_animation_bs{font-family:OhnoSoftieDemo-Medium;font-size:48px;max-width:100%;margin:auto;position:absolute;z-index:2;top:36vw;left:0;color:#808ba8;line-height:56px;width:100%}a#cart-icon-bubble{display:none}a.njhejgfuytgrygfrvytfyr{display:block;max-width:120px!important;height:auto}.account_and_buttons_bs.head a img{max-width:39px;display:block}.left_cta_buttons.head{margin:0!important}}
/*# sourceMappingURL=/cdn/shop/t/3/assets/custom.css.map */
